Output aa85e5107bf0803acce0d4de77fb3d085ffbca70065819b470e33f4b9253c7a4:29

value
3357792
script pubkey
OP_0 OP_PUSHBYTES_20 e9ce300a4d7e957aeb9ea9435dc2ebcf7afcb68d
address
bc1qa88rqzjd062h46u749p4mshteaa0ed5d7rx6jl
transaction
aa85e5107bf0803acce0d4de77fb3d085ffbca70065819b470e33f4b9253c7a4
spent
true